Tamron 17-35 F2.8 XR DI IF
Just wondering if anyone has any comments or examples of photos taken with this lens. After deliberating long and hard over the 17-40L, I just don't think I can justify the cost. The reviews I've read on the Tamron seem to think that it's an excellent little lens for the money, and it's just about within budget. I've read a few positive comments about it on here, but I'd like to see examples if possible.
I'd like to know just how large the CA problem is too, since that's what really annoys me about the kit lens. Also, any other suggestions for a lens to replace my kit lens would be greatly appreciated. I want it to be approx 17-18mm at the wide end. Don't think I'd have any use for one as wide as 10mm, because the distortion will be ridiculous.. especially as most of my shots will be architecture. The range on the kit lens is absolutely perfect, I just want something of better quality. Thanks in advance for any help
